What Research and Lab Testing Tell Us About Hubs

A combination of laboratory bench tests, field testing by independent cycling publications, and engineering research in tribology and materials science informs the benefits of different hub designs. Studies and controlled tests consistently show that sealed-bearing systems better resist contamination than open cup-and-cone arrangements when exposed to water and road salts, while engagement mechanism design (pawls versus ratchet systems) affects perceived responsiveness and the amount of freeplay under load. Hub flange width, axle stiffness, and boost spacing measurably influence lateral stiffness and wheel durability, which can translate to more accurate handling and improved power transfer on climbs and sprints. Below are accessible, research-informed takeaways useful for beginners and experienced riders alike.

Sealed bearings reduce contamination ingress and often extend service intervals compared with unsealed cup-and-cone systems, particularly in wet or winter conditions.

Higher engagement counts reduce the angular 'dead zone' before power is transferred; this improves instant acceleration but may require more precise maintenance of pawls or ratchet interfaces.

Thru-axles and wider 'boost' spacing increase wheel stiffness and can improve handling precision, especially on modern mountain bikes and e-bikes.

Material choice (aluminum, steel, or hardened alloys) and heat treatment impact long-term durability and weight; fatigue testing in labs helps predict lifespan under load.

Freehub body standards (Shimano HG, Shimano Micro Spline, SRAM XD/XDR, Campagnolo) determine cassette compatibility and should be matched to drivetrain choice to avoid premature wear and poor shifting.

In the American context, selecting the right hub means balancing weather resistance, drivetrain compatibility, and the engagement/spacing features that match your riding style.
